From bb3397f8518b459cac86533b7076543db1452dc4 Mon Sep 17 00:00:00 2001 From: Iain Holmes Date: Fri, 16 Aug 2002 13:49:37 +0000 Subject: Import into the default book not the local one svn path=/trunk/; revision=17788 --- addressbook/ChangeLog | 7 +++++++ addressbook/backend/ebook/evolution-ldif-importer.c | 7 ++++++- addressbook/backend/ebook/evolution-vcard-importer.c | 6 ++++++ 3 files changed, 19 insertions(+), 1 deletion(-) diff --git a/addressbook/ChangeLog b/addressbook/ChangeLog index 3a7c7494ba..1377c572e8 100644 --- a/addressbook/ChangeLog +++ b/addressbook/ChangeLog @@ -1,3 +1,10 @@ +2002-08-16 Iain + + * backends/e-book/evolution-ldif-importer.c (ebook_create): Use the + default EBook instead of the local one. + + * backends/e-book/evolution-vcard-importer.c (ebook_create): Ditto. + 2002-08-16 Chris Toshok * backend/pas/pas-backend-ldap.c (book_view_notify_status): new diff --git a/addressbook/backend/ebook/evolution-ldif-importer.c b/addressbook/backend/ebook/evolution-ldif-importer.c index 60ac899e81..d792a74172 100644 --- a/addressbook/backend/ebook/evolution-ldif-importer.c +++ b/addressbook/backend/ebook/evolution-ldif-importer.c @@ -460,7 +460,7 @@ ebook_create (LDIFImporter *gci) __FUNCTION__); return; } - +#if 0 path = g_concat_dir_and_file (g_get_home_dir (), "evolution/local/Contacts/addressbook.db"); uri = g_strdup_printf ("file://%s", path); @@ -470,6 +470,11 @@ ebook_create (LDIFImporter *gci) printf ("error calling load_uri!\n"); } g_free(uri); +#endif + + if (! e_book_load_default_book (gci->book, book_open_cb, gci)) { + g_warning ("Error calling load_default_book"); + } } /* EvolutionImporter methods */ diff --git a/addressbook/backend/ebook/evolution-vcard-importer.c b/addressbook/backend/ebook/evolution-vcard-importer.c index e32593b4fb..9e0a475977 100644 --- a/addressbook/backend/ebook/evolution-vcard-importer.c +++ b/addressbook/backend/ebook/evolution-vcard-importer.c @@ -58,6 +58,7 @@ ebook_create (VCardImporter *gci) return; } +#if 0 path = g_concat_dir_and_file (g_get_home_dir (), "evolution/local"); uri = g_strdup_printf ("file://%s", path); g_free (path); @@ -71,6 +72,11 @@ ebook_create (VCardImporter *gci) printf ("error calling load_uri!\n"); } g_free(uri); +#endif + + if (! e_book_load_default_book (gci->book, book_open_cb, gci)) { + g_warning ("Error calling load_default_book"); + } } /* EvolutionImporter methods */ -- cgit v1.2.3